Tar roof repair services focus on fixing issues related to flat or low-sloped roofing systems commonly used on residential properties. These projects typically involve addressing leaks, repairing or replacing damaged membrane sections, sealing around vents and flashing, and patching areas affected by weather or aging. Property owners often seek these services to prevent further damage, maintain the integrity of their roof, and protect the interior of their home from water intrusion.

Before requesting tar roof repairs, homeowners usually want to understand the extent of the damage, the recommended repair methods, and the expected lifespan of the fixes. It’s important to consider the age of the roof, the severity of leaks or damage, and any underlying issues that may require more extensive work. Clear communication about the scope of the repair and a detailed assessment can help ensure the project meets the needs of the property while maintaining the roof’s durability.

Tar Roof Repair Questions

What causes tar roof damage? Common causes include weather exposure, UV rays, and aging materials that lead to cracks and leaks.

How can I tell if my tar roof need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, blistering, pooling water, or leaks inside the building.

What types of repairs are typical for tar roofs? Repairs often involve patching cracks, sealing seams, and replacing damaged sections to restore waterproofing.

Is it better to repair or replace a tar roof? Repair is suitable for minor damage, while extensive deterioration may require a full roof replacement for long-term durability.
